  • Maintain A Good Credit Score

Most, if not all, money lenders use your records to determine your eligibility to receive their loan. If you are a regular defaulter, then your request for a loan – as small as it may be – will be rejected. A clean track record works to your advantage as a lender can trust that you are capable of paying them back. Having a good credit score basically means that you have paid all your previous loans plus the interest on time.

  • Give Accurate Information

When applying for a loan, a company does require all their applicants to fill in a form to provide relevant information about themselves. The most common data they need may include your full names, government ID details, age, or gender, among others. Other firms may require additional pieces of information such as what you intend to use the money for, so on and so forth. While completing such information may seem cumbersome to you, they are of great importance to the loan providing company. You should fill in only accurate information, asif you are not truthful, you may be rejected. Most of these organisations work hand in hand with governmental bodies, meaning they have access to some of your information. And if they compare the information already in the system to what you gave them and they don’t tally, your request is denied.
